The focus of this job will be to develop and deploy a community engagement and education program at Pine Creek Conservation District.

Pine Creek Conservation District is located in northeast Whitman County serving the areas in and around Oakesdale, Tekoa, Rosalia, Farmington, Thornton, Malden, Pine City. Our mission is to simultaneously maximize efficient and profitable agriculture and diverse and functional ecosystems by working with residents to voluntarily protect, enhance and restore natural resources in the Pine Creek Conservation District. We aim to accomplish our mission by providing actionable information and education on natural resource conservation as well as technical and financial assistance to support conservation projects. To find out more, you can read our annual plan of work on our website pinecreekcd.org/annual-plan-of-work.

The successful candidate will use a variety of communication, education, and marketing strategies to promote conservation agriculture, habitat preservation and restoration, wildfire resiliency and other District objectives. They will work closely with District staff and partner organizations in developing and disseminating multi-media content, in-person workshops, volunteer opportunities, public information booths, and classroom education.
